SecondTicket 2019 Preview and 2018 Recap

2018 was a record year for SecondTicket, thanks to you, our ever-growing fan community and corporate clients. We sold more tickets than ever before, and our exclusive presentation of The Mega Pool continued attracting new customers and fans. We are excited for more growth again in 2019.

WHY SECONDTICKET?
The evolution of ticket technology during our 11 years in business has amplified demand for professional expertise before making a purchase. As new marketplaces such as SeatGeek, Vivid Seats and TickPick emerge as competition to Stubhub and Ticketmaster, and as pricing and delivery methods become more sophisticated across the ticketing spectrum, fans increasingly want to talk to someone they can trust before investing in tickets.

We will always help you identify the best values and are not afraid to recommend buying tickets on a different site. Most of them provide a good end-user experience and protection.

THE 2018 AND 2019 MEGA POOL
The two biggest differentiators between SecondTicket.com and other ticket marketplaces are our personal service and the most valuable loyalty program in the industry. Flash sales or discount offers from most sites generally save you 5-10% and are for limited times when you may not need tickets. But the average savings among SecondTicket fans who have redeemed credits in our 11 year history is 13%, and credits you win are valid for at least six months. Fans won more than $3,700 in credits in 2018 alone, and the general credit structure won't change in 2019 (although it will change slightly for The Monday Night Ticket Score).

We are, however, continuing to adjust the point structure to make The Mega Pool as competitive as possible. Points available in the WayCool Super Ticket Pool will be doubled in 2019, and points available in the All-Star Ticket Slam and Monday Night Ticket Score are being reduced by 40% and 25%, respectively.
